Owner Experience Review
Owners who run the 830fromFerretti Yachtstypically use its four-cabin, eight-guest layout for family cruising, and many examples are set up for weekend entertaining on the large flybridge. The accommodations feel generous for the size, with an owner’s stateroom widely noted as especially spacious. The same attributes make the yacht a popular choice for Mediterranean charters, from day trips to full‑day outings; one TripAdvisor guest described their day as “such a fun and lovely day!! Highly recommend it !!!!”.
On the water, the 830delivers brisk planing performance, with published figures around 29–31 knots at cruise and about 33 knots at the top, considered fast for her size. For a 25–26 m planing yacht, the hull feels composed; CE/A classification underscores an ocean‑capable design, and some boats were specified with an optional ARG gyro anti‑roll system.
Maintenance expectations align with the powertrain: many 830yachts carry MTU 2000‑series engines requiring attentive oil, fuel‑filtration, and cooling‑system care, with higher service costs than smaller diesel yachts. Older hulls frequently undergo periodic refits (electronics, gensets, interior), and the compact engine room and systems routing—typical of Italian flybridge builds—often prompt owners to plan access improvements such as better hose runs and clamps.
